What about employer relocation programs — does selling to BuyHousesInCash affect them?

Some employers cover real estate commissions or guaranteed-buyout programs for relocating employees. Selling to us saves the commission cost, which sometimes triggers different employer reimbursement. Check your relocation policy — selling for a slightly lower price quickly may net more than waiting for a higher traditional sale price minus commissions and double mortgage carrying costs.

Carrying two mortgages during relocation is the most common financial stress for Woodbury County relocating homeowners. Original mortgage continues; new mortgage in the new city starts. Standard Iowa timelines mean 60-180 days of double-payments. Selling the Woodbury home for cash before the move eliminates the second-mortgage period entirely.
